Henry VIII never expected to reign, and like so many second
Sons he was given a freedom not given to the heir. But on
The death of his brother Arthur, he was thrust into kingship
School by his authoritarian father, Henry VII. His early
Years fulfilled his warrior ambitions, winning battles in France
And Scotland. Six marriages and the creation of the Church
Of England point to a monarch who was less than conventional
Succeeding to the throne in 1509 at the age of 17, he married his
Brother's widow, Catherine of Aragon. The well-known split with
Rome and the subsequent Reformation was a direct result of divorce
From Catherine. Then followed the other five wives: Anne Boleyn
Executed, Jane Seymour died, Anne of Cleves divorced, Katherine
Howard beheaded, and finally Katherine Parr, who outlived him
A man of many parts, associated with the field of the cloth of gold
Music and scholarly pursuits, and a strong defence of Christian
Piety. Juxtapose this with his love of jousting
Hunting, tennis, and in his younger days an athletic
Prowess that was the talk of Europe, and you understand
Why Henry VIII was such a force in our island's history
When Henry died, in January 1547, he was 55 years
Old and boasted a Falstaffian girth of 54 inches
